Bust out the 10-gallon hats, Dallas (as if they weren’t already out), because country superstar Brad Paisley is coming to your neck of the woods! On Saturday, July 27, Paisley will head over to the Gexa Energy Pavilion for the next stop on his “Beat This Summer” Tour! Joining Paisley will be Lee Brice, Chris Young, and The Henningsens, so it’s a show we’re sure you’ll want to see. Operated by Live Nation, Gexa Energy Pavilion (located in the Fair Park section of Dallas, TX), is a venue with an ample amount of name changes. Opened in 1988 as the Coca-Cola Starplex Amphitheatre, Coke’s naming rights expired in 1998, and in 2000, these rights were sold to Smirnoff Vodka, making the venue the Smirnoff Music Centre. Superpages.com picked up naming rights in 2008, and Gexa Energy in 2011, giving the pavilion the name it has today.
